Output 24dfe7553176aea8504f0e20d180bdb8daf546f112848d8212a7dbf751f916c3:0

value
70428509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f907add8199e20ebb8a71674153e030b58f01b07 OP_EQUAL
address
3QPmNruZU76z2fZqgHnEeHZ7Wp48vEqBpk
transaction
24dfe7553176aea8504f0e20d180bdb8daf546f112848d8212a7dbf751f916c3
spent
true